The county
was established in 1858 and named in honor of Augustin Smith Clayton
(1783-1839), who served in the United States House of Representatives
from 1832 until 1835.
The county seat is Jonesboro
Cities and Towns
College Park
-- Forest Park -- Jonesboro -- Lake City
Lovejoy -- Morrow -- Riverdale
Adjacent
Counties
DeKalb County (northeast)
Henry County (east)
Spalding County (south)
Fayette County (southwest)
Fulton County (northwest)
